I had some lab work done because of mild joint pain. it came back ana positive and speckled and ana titer 1:40. what does this mean?

Low positive ANA: Low level ANA antibodies (1:40 or below) are often not big concern for autoimmune diseases however; it is possible that your joint pains are related to systemic lupus erythematosis (sle). An evaluation by a specialist is suggested (rheumatology).
